About this course

With the increasing demand for mental health professionals who can address these concerns, this course offers a unique opportunity for career advancement. Learners will gain a deep understanding of the psychological and social factors that contribute to loneliness and technology overuse. They will develop the ability to assess and diagnose technology-related issues and design interventions for individuals and organizations. The course curriculum is designed to equip learners with evidence-based practices and tools to promote healthy technology use and build meaningful connections in a digital age. By completing this program, learners will distinguish themselves as forward-thinking professionals who are prepared to address one of the most critical challenges facing society today. This certificate course is an excellent opportunity for mental health professionals, educators, coaches, and anyone interested in promoting digital well-being and mental health.

Course Details

  • Understanding Loneliness: Causes and Consequences
  • Technology Overuse: Definition and Prevalence
  • The Intersection of Loneliness and Technology Overuse
  • Impact of Social Media on Mental Health
  • The Role of Smartphones in Loneliness and Isolation
  • Developing Healthy Technology Habits
  • Mindfulness and Digital Detox: Practical Strategies
  • Supporting Others Experiencing Loneliness and Technology Overuse
  • Policies and Regulations: Addressing Technology Overuse
  • Future Trends: Loneliness, Technology, and Society
